  41. <script id="fragmentShader" type="x-shader/x-fragment">
  42. uniform float time;
  43. uniform float fogDensity;
  44. uniform vec3 fogColor;
  45. uniform sampler2D texture1;
  46. uniform sampler2D texture2;
  47. varying vec2 vUv;
  48. void main( void ) {
  49. vec2 position = - 1.0 + 2.0 * vUv;
  50. vec4 noise = texture2D( texture1, vUv );
  51. vec2 T1 = vUv + vec2( 1.5, - 1.5 ) * time * 0.02;
  52. vec2 T2 = vUv + vec2( - 0.5, 2.0 ) * time * 0.01;
  53. T1.x += noise.x * 2.0;
  54. T1.y += noise.y * 2.0;
  55. T2.x -= noise.y * 0.2;
  56. T2.y += noise.z * 0.2;
  57. float p = texture2D( texture1, T1 * 2.0 ).a;
  58. vec4 color = texture2D( texture2, T2 * 2.0 );
  59. vec4 temp = color * ( vec4( p, p, p, p ) * 2.0 ) + ( color * color - 0.1 );
  60. if( temp.r > 1.0 ) { temp.bg += clamp( temp.r - 2.0, 0.0, 100.0 ); }
  61. if( temp.g > 1.0 ) { temp.rb += temp.g - 1.0; }
  62. if( temp.b > 1.0 ) { temp.rg += temp.b - 1.0; }
  63. gl_FragColor = temp;
  64. float depth = gl_FragCoord.z / gl_FragCoord.w;
  65. const float LOG2 = 1.442695;
  66. float fogFactor = exp2( - fogDensity * fogDensity * depth * depth * LOG2 );
  67. fogFactor = 1.0 - clamp( fogFactor, 0.0, 1.0 );
  68. gl_FragColor = mix( gl_FragColor, vec4( fogColor, gl_FragColor.w ), fogFactor );
  69. }
  70. </script>
  71. <script id="vertexShader" type="x-shader/x-vertex">
  72. uniform vec2 uvScale;
  73. varying vec2 vUv;
  74. void main()
  75. {
  76. vUv = uvScale * uv;
  77. vec4 mvPosition = modelViewMatrix * vec4( position, 1.0 );
  78. gl_Position = projectionMatrix * mvPosition;
  79. }
  80. </script>
